Subject: Handover — Linkgate routing tables

Plugin authors: deep-link routes for Linkgate now live in the `route_map` table, not the old YAML file. Register new URI patterns via the admin endpoint; direct inserts will be rejected after Friday. Wildcard routes need a priority value or they're ignored. For read-only verification of your entries, query the routing database at the connection string below.

warehouse DSN: mssql://rusdor_svc:0FSWCn9@db-951a.paliqforge.local:5432/ulawyn

The renewal of our three-year agreement with Torvane Materials has been assessed in detail. Proposed terms include a 4.2% unit-price increase, partially offset by improved volume rebates and extended payment terms of sixty days. Sensitivity analysis indicates a net annual cost impact of under 1% on the Meridia product line, assuming stable demand. Legal has flagged no material changes to liability clauses. We recommend approval, subject to the conditions outlined in the confidential note below.

confidential, yawip-bahif: Zorokox Partners plans to lower the Casax list price by 28.0 percent in April. The board signed off on a budget of $271.0 million for Project Juldor. The renewal with Pelokox Partners closes at $410.1 million a year, 3.4 percent below the last contract. Project Pelok slips by a full year because of the audit delay.

## Releases

Heads up: v2.4.1 ships a fix for the query planner regression that snuck into Quillbase last month — joins on partitioned tables were picking the slow path. Nothing security-relevant changed in the planner itself, but do skim the diff anyway. All release tarballs are verified against the key below before deploy.

signing key of yajog-kafof = bky19_orbYRY3Abj3KpZesMie

## Approvals: Queuewick Log Compaction

Heads up, security folks: compaction on the Queuewick broker permanently drops superseded messages, so any change to retention keys needs a review pass. We check that compacted segments can't leak tombstoned payloads and that audit topics are exempt. All compaction-policy changes require one approval before merge. Final approval comes from the person below.

account owner for bawip-tahag: Raleth Quenok